•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

[geloest] reihenfolge in /etc/fstab

Hi
Ich habe ein bootproblem, teile meiner devices werden nicht gemounted, ich vermute das liegt daran, dass ein device in der /etc/fstab Probleme macht.

Nun frage ich mich spielt die Reihenfolge von devices in der /etc/fstab eine Rolle (und welche... :D ).

Meine /etc/fstab

/dev/disk/by-id/scsi-SATA_WDC_WD740GD-50FWD-WMAKE2213960-part2 / ext3 acl,user_xattr 1 1
/dev/disk/by-id/scsi-SATA_WDC_WD740GD-50FWD-WMAKE2213960-part1 swap swap defaults 0 0
proc /proc proc defaults 0 0
sysfs /sys sysfs noauto 0 0
debugfs /sys/kernel/debug debugfs noauto 0 0
usbfs /proc/bus/usb usbfs noauto 0 0
devpts /dev/pts devpts mode=0620,gid=5 0 0
/dev/fd0 /media/floppy auto noauto,user,sync 0 0
/dev/disk/by-id/scsi-SATA_SAMSUNG_HD753LJS13UJ1NQ221701-part1 /oldraid/ ext3 acl,user_xattr 1 2
/dev/disk/by-id/scsi-20004d927fffff800-part1 /raid/ xfs defaults 1 2


ich vermute dass das device usbfs /proc/bus/usb probleme macht.

Als resultat wird die beiden grossen datentraeger in den letzten beiden Zeilen beim booten nicht automatisch gemounted - ich kann sie aber problemlos manuel mounten..

Ich wuerde nun gerne die reihenfolge aendern:

/dev/disk/by-id/scsi-SATA_WDC_WD740GD-50FWD-WMAKE2213960-part2 / ext3 acl,user_xattr 1 1
/dev/disk/by-id/scsi-SATA_WDC_WD740GD-50FWD-WMAKE2213960-part1 swap swap defaults 0 0
/dev/disk/by-id/scsi-SATA_SAMSUNG_HD753LJS13UJ1NQ221701-part1 /oldraid/ ext3 acl,user_xattr 1 2
/dev/disk/by-id/scsi-20004d927fffff800-part1 /raid/ xfs defaults 1 2
proc /proc proc defaults 0 0
sysfs /sys sysfs noauto 0 0
debugfs /sys/kernel/debug debugfs noauto 0 0
usbfs /proc/bus/usb usbfs noauto 0 0
devpts /dev/pts devpts mode=0620,gid=5 0 0
/dev/fd0 /media/floppy auto noauto,user,sync 0 0


macht das sinn oder schrotte ich damit mein System?
Wo kann ich nachlesen ob was beim booten schiefgegangen ist? (ein Logfile oder so...)

Dank und Gruss
M.
 
Zeige doch mal die Ausgabe, die beim booten kommt. Dann könnte man vielleicht etwas dazu sagen, warum der Fehler passiert.
 
Hi,

die Reihenfolge spielt aufjeden Fall eine große Rolle. Laut der Reihenfolge in der fstab werden die Platten angesprochen.

mit dem Befehl

Code:
fdisk -l

als root

bekommst Du die Ausgabe, welche Blöcke die Partitionen einnehmen. Daran musst Du dich in der fstab halten.

Bitte poste mal die Ausgabe von
Code:
fdisk -l

als root.
 
B435:/ # fdisk -l

Disk /dev/sda: 74.3 GB, 74355769344 bytes
255 heads, 63 sectors/track, 9039 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es
Disk identifier: 0x000bac2b

Device Boot Start End Blocks Id System
/dev/sda1 1 1045 8393931 82 Linux swap / Solaris
/dev/sda2 * 1046 9009 63970830 83 Linux

Disk /dev/sdb: 750.1 GB, 750156374016 bytes
255 heads, 63 sectors/track, 91201 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es
Disk identifier: 0x000004ad

Device Boot Start End Blocks Id System
/dev/sdb1 1 91201 732572001 83 Linux

WARNING: GPT (GUID Partition Table) detected on '/dev/sdc'! The util fdisk doesn't support GPT. Use GNU Parted.


Disk /dev/sdc: 2999.9 GB, 2999999004672 bytes
255 heads, 63 sectors/track, 364729 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es
Disk identifier: 0x00000000

Device Boot Start End Blocks Id System
/dev/sdc1 1 267350 2147483647+ ee EFI GPT
 
1. Schau in der Datei /var/log/boot.msg nach, ob Du im Zusammenhang mit den fehlgeschlagenen Einhängeversuchen etwas findest (suche z. B. nach "mount" bzw. "failed").

2. Ich hätte gerne noch die Ausgabe von:
Code:
ls -l /dev/disk/by-id
3. Was hat es mit dem Partition-Typ von sdc1 (ee = EFI GPT) auf sich? Ich weiß, er ist gültig, aber bis jetzt ist er mir noch nicht untergekommen.

4. Hast du vielleicht noch Reste eines RAID-Verbunds?

3. Deine fstab-Umstellung kannst du ohne weiteres machen, sie wird aber das Problem nicht lösen.
 
Keine reste von einem RAID sondern ein funktionierendes RAID...
Ich habe ein Raid5 array mit 5 750 Gb Platten. (adaptec raid card).
Das macht 3Tb und das konnte nicht ueber die YaST tools partitioniert und formatiert werden da diese auf fdisk aufbauen und fdisk nur bis maximal 2Tb unterstuetzt. Daher musste ich das RAID array mit GPT partitionieren und formatieren, anschliessend habe ich das RAID array aber via YaST ins System eingebunden. Ich habe die option via disk id gewahlt, da der RAID adapter 8 (hotswap) ports hat und ich bei einem davon immer andere Festplatten anschliesse (fuer Backup...). Sowas bringt die klassische dev/sda gerne durcheinader und dann gibts beim booten Kernel panick und so ne sachen die man nicht will ...

ich musste noch mal booten (Problem mit den USP) bei diesem booten ging "leider" alles glatt. Keine Ahnung warum???

also habe ich in der /var/log/boot.msg kein mount failure mehr gefunden.
allerdings habe ich folgendes gefunden:


<3>ck804xrom ck804xrom_init_one(): Unable to register resource 0x00000000ffb00000-0x00000000ffffffff - kernel bug?
<6>i2c-adapter i2c-0: nForce2 SMBus adapter at 0x5000
<6>i2c-adapter i2c-1: nForce2 SMBus adapter at 0x5040
<7>CFI: Found no ck804xrom @ffc00000 device at location zero
<7>JEDEC: Found no ck804xrom @ffc00000 device at location zero
<7>CFI: Found no ck804xrom @ffc00000 device at location zero
.
.
.
line 448 bis 780 sehen so aus, (mit verschiedenen adressen)
dann geht es weiter mit
7>CFI: Found no ck804xrom @fff00000 device at location zero
<4>Found: SST 49LF080A
<6>ck804xrom @fff00000: Found 1 x8 devices at 0x0 in 8-bit bank
<5>number of JEDEC chips: 1
<5>cfi_cmdset_0002: Disabling erase-suspend-program due to code brokenness.
<4>sr0: scsi3-mmc drive: 48x/48x writer dvd-ram cd/rw xa/form2 cdda tray

M.
 
Danke für die Informationen hinsichtlich GPT.

Ich liebe Fehler, die nur fallweise auftreten. Wenn es wieder einmal der Fall ist, würde ich zuerst versuchen, das Einhängen mittels "mount -a" vorzunehmen. Vielleicht gibt es dann eine Fehlermeldung, vielleicht ist es ein durch die anderen Fehler verursachtes (Zeit-)Problem, ...

Deine Boot-Fehlermeldungen sagen mir leider nichts. Du solltest den Betreff des ersten Beitrags entsprechend ändern (oder ein neues Theme eröffnen).

An marce: "auto" ist die Standardannahme.
 
danke Jungs, das booten klappt jetzt wieder einwandfrei. Habe die Reihenfolge in der etc/fstab geaendert und fuer das USB-dongle auto eingefuegt.
Cheers
M.
 
Oben